Job description

JOB INFORMATION

Job Title: Ophthalmology Consultant

SHORT DESCRIPTION

An Excellent opportunity to join as Ophthalmology Consultant for one of the most prestigious and top tier leading Hospital in Dallah -Al Ahsa Saudi Arabia

JOB SUMMARY

Join one of the leading hospital as a consultant in ophthalmology, where you will lead the ophthalmology department, provide expert guidance on eye care services, collaborate with medical professionals to optimize patient care, drive training and development initiatives, and oversee the implementation of best practices in ophthalmic services.

MAIN D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Provides high-quality ophthalmology care to patients in this area of medicine.
  • Provide consultative service as requested.
  • Supervise fellows, staff/assistant physicians, and residents.
  • Actively participates in the training and teaching of residents and fellows in his area of expertise and Participates in research activities.
  • Participates in committees and other administrative functions as needed.
  • Performs special procedures as privileged.
  • Follows all hospital-related policies and procedures.
  • Performs other related duties as assigned.

REQUIRED QUALIFICATIONS

Education

  • Graduate from a medical school of good standing.
  • Completion of required period of training in ophthalmology.
  • (Arab , Jordanian, Lebanese)Board certification in ophthalmology is typically required or equivalent.
  • Membership and/or Fellowship or their equivalent and fulfilling the criteria for the consultant as required
  • A certificate recognized by the Saudi commission is a must.
  • Dataflow is a must.

Professional Experience

  • Min. 5 years Post Board/Fellowship in ophthalmology.
  • A registered member of the Saudi Board Council

Language

  • Proficiency in English; additional proficiency in Arabic may be beneficial.

References

  • Positive professional references attesting to the candidate's skills and ethical conduct.
